Output 758866a7a05f66e14be5a0b17050c69d3a99c995b65acd21823df11aca5d9d83:683

value
16786
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3ee1f69a69060635d8b2590c9791236110a3932ee3ec71dc1e71c154e1b222d
address
bc1pu0hp76dxjpsxxhvtykgvj7gjxcgs5wfjaclvw8wpuuwp2nsmygksu7j5mp
transaction
758866a7a05f66e14be5a0b17050c69d3a99c995b65acd21823df11aca5d9d83
spent
true